Getting There

  • Car

    If you are driving from anywhere in Northern Kentucky, head towards Covington, KY. Use I-75 S/I-71 S and take exit 192A for 5th St toward Covington. Continue on 5th St and take a left onto the John A. Roebling Suspension Bridge. Parking is available in nearby lots, but be aware of potential parking fees which can vary from $5 to $10 depending on the location.

  • Public Transportation

    For those using public transportation, check the local bus services such as TANK (Transit Authority of Northern Kentucky). You can take Bus Route 1 or 4 to the Covington area. Get off at the stop closest to the 5th St and then walk towards the bridge. The walk is approximately 10-15 minutes. Be sure to check the TANK schedule for the latest routing and fare information, which may cost around $1.75 for a one-way trip.

  • Walking

    If you are staying in Covington or nearby, walking is a pleasant option. From downtown Covington, head towards the riverfront area and follow the signs to the John A. Roebling Suspension Bridge. The bridge is easily accessible and the walk is scenic, with views of the river. It should take about 15-20 minutes from the downtown area.

Discover more about John A. Roebling Suspension Bridge

The John A. Roebling Suspension Bridge stands as a testament to 19th-century engineering brilliance, connecting Covington, Kentucky, and Cincinnati, Ohio across the majestic Ohio River. Opened in 1866, this architectural marvel was designed by John A. Roebling, who later went on to create the famous Brooklyn Bridge. Its intricate design, characterized by soaring towers and sweeping cables, provides a striking contrast against the vibrant urban skyline. Visitors can enjoy a leisurely stroll across the bridge, taking in panoramic views of the river and the cities on either side, making it an ideal spot for photography enthusiasts and casual walkers alike. As a popular tourist attraction, the bridge is not only a functional thoroughfare but also a historical landmark. It serves as a reminder of the industrial era in which it was built and remains a cherished piece of the region's heritage. The bridge is pedestrian-friendly, allowing visitors to traverse its length at a relaxed pace while soaking in the scenery. Along the way, informative plaques detail the bridge's history and significance, enhancing the educational experience for tourists.
